COMMONWEALTH v. SICKLER et al.


214 Pa.Super. 463 (1969)

Commonwealth v. Sickler et al., Appellant.

Superior Court of Pennsylvania.

June 13, 1969.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

James Scanlon, Jr., for appellant.

James E. O'Brien, First Assistant District Attorney, with him Joseph J. Cimino, District Attorney, for Commonwealth, appellee.

Before WRIGHT, P.J., WATKINS, MONTGOMERY, JACOBS, HOFFMAN, SPAULDING, and HANNUM, JJ.


OPINION BY HOFFMAN, J., June 13, 1969:

The instant case is a companion to Commonwealth v. Savage, 214 Pa.Super. 460, 257 A.2d 654 (1969). Appellant was retried for burglary on October 4, 1965, with codefendant Savage, and found guilty by a jury.
